The main motives for formulating the 1931 Ethiopian Constitution were to modernize the country's legal system, establish a framework for governance that would balance traditional Ethiopian practices with Western elements, and to strengthen Emperor Haile Selassie's central authority. The constitution aimed to codify the laws of the empire and provide a legal basis for the government's actions.

Q: What are the motives for formulating the 1931ethiopian constitution?

Which Greek philosopher is given credit for formulating paradoxes that defended specific beliefs about motion?

Zeno of Elea is the Greek philosopher credited with formulating paradoxes that defend specific beliefs about motion. His best-known paradoxes, such as the paradox of Achilles and the Tortoise and the Dichotomy paradox, were designed to challenge the idea of motion and the concept of infinity.

How many constitutions has the Philippines had?

The Philippines has had five constitutions in its history: the Malolos Constitution (1899), the 1935 Constitution, the 1943 Constitution, the 1973 Constitution, and the 1987 Constitution.
